SPEAKING WITH TONGUES
1 Corinthians 14:2
[2]For he that speaketh in an unknown tongue speaketh not unto men, but unto God: for no man understandeth him; howbeit in the spirit he speaketh mysteries.
Tongues is a gift in the spirit of every believer and language spoken by believers. In Mark 16:17
".... they shall speak with new tongues;" the "they" refers to those who believe the gospel of Jesus preached, in other words, "the believing ones". From our text, the word "speaketh" was translated from the Greek word "laleo" which is defined as a natural and regular action. It means a regular activity of speaking. Note that when words used in the translation of the scriptures are well explained and understood within context, the right meaning will be in view. Speaking with tongues is a spiritual mode of communication, and since believers are the ones who speak with tongues, who are tongues addressed to? Take note from our text, "... speaketh not unto men, but unto God..." this implies that it is not addressed to anybody in humanity, but the believer communicates with God. That is, he creates an audience with God (spiritually communicates with God). Still from our text, "... for no man understandeth him, howbeit in the spirit he speaketh mysteries", it means the human mind can not comprehend it. Note this, "...he speaketh mysteries" "musterion" from the the Greek word which implies an undisclosed fact/that which needs to be explained. Then, it suffices say that mysteries refers to a set of facts that have not been disclosed or explained. This disclosure will be a Revelation. Therefore, speaking with tongues is an ability or aspiritual mode of communication to God by believers in Christ verbalized clearly in the spirit and is not a human language. Within the scope of the communication the believer utters Supernatural discussion initiated where in God's thoughts are exchanged with ours.
